Show: Full Specs/Additional configurations

Network: Technology:
GSM / CDMA / HSPA / LTE / 5G
Launch: Announced: 2020, December 10
Status: Available. Released 2021, January 07
Body: Dimensions: 159.1 x 73.4 x 7.9 mm (6.26 x 2.89 x 0.31 in)
Weight: 172 g or 180 g (6.07 oz)
SIM: Dual SIM (Nano-SIM, dual stand-by)
Display: Type: AMOLED, 90Hz, 430 nits (typ), 750 nits (peak)
Size: 6.43 inches, 99.3 cm2 (~85.1% screen-to-body ratio)
Resolution: 1080 x 2400 pixels, 20:9 ratio (~410 ppi density)
Protection: Corning Gorilla Glass 5
Platform: OS: Android 11, ColorOS 11.1
Chipset: Qualcomm SM7250 Snapdragon 765G 5G (7 nm)
CPU: Octa-core (1x2.4 GHz Kryo 475 Prime & 1x2.2 GHz Kryo 475 Gold & 6x1.8 GHz Kryo 475 Silver)
GPU: Adreno 620
Memory: Card slot: No
Internal: 128GB 8GB RAM, 256GB 12GB RAM
: UFS 2.1
Main Camera: Quad: 64 MP, f/1.7, 26mm (wide), 1/1.73", 0.8µm, PDAF
8 MP, f/2.2, 119˚ (ultrawide), 1/4.0", 1.12µm
2 MP, f/2.4, (macro)
2 MP, f/2.4, (depth)
Features: LED flash, HDR, panorama
Video: 4K@30fps, 1080p@30/60/120fps; gyro-EIS, HDR
Selfie camera: Single: 32 MP, f/2.4, 24mm (wide), 1/2.8", 0.8µm
Features: HDR
Video: 1080p@30fps, gyro-EIS
Sound: Loudspeaker: Yes
3.5mm jack: Yes
Comms: WLAN: Wi-Fi 802.11 a/b/g/n/ac, dual-band, Wi-Fi Direct, hotspot
Bluetooth: 5.1, A2DP, LE, aptX HD
GPS: Yes, with dual-band A-GPS, GLONASS, BDS, GALILEO, QZSS
NFC: Yes (market/region dependent)
Radio: No
USB: USB Type-C 3.1, USB On-The-Go
Features: Sensors: Fingerprint (under display, optical), accelerometer, gyro, proximity, compass
Battery: Type: Li-Po 4300 mAh, non-removable
Charging: Fast charging 65W, 100% in 35 min (advertised)
Reverse charging
SuperVOOC 2.0

Install Instructions

Step 1 — Download and extract the Android USB Driver to your PC.

Step 2 — Click Start (Windows) -> Control Panel -> Device Manager (Select Device Manager).

Step 3 — On the Device Manager window find and click on computer name to select Add legacy hardware.

Step 4 — Select Next

Step 5 — Selext Install the hardware that I manually select from a list (Advanced), and click the Next

Step 6 — Select Show All Devices afterward click Next button again.

Step 7 — Click the Have Disk button.

Step 8 — Click Browse button to find the extracted Android ADB Driver -> android_winusb.inf and click on Open.

Step 9 — Click OK.

Step 10 — Now select the Android ADB Interface -> click Next button.

Step 11 — Click Next button again.

Step 12 — Windows Security box will appear, to confirm whether you really want to install the Android USB Driver, so just choose the Install this driver software anyway.

Step 13 — Once you clicked the Finish button, then repeat from step 2 to choose Android Composite ADB Interface.

Step 14  - Done.
